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to address various foundation-related issues. This process typically includes lifting a building off its existing foundation, performing necessary repairs or modifications, and then setting it back onto a new or improved foundation. The goal is to restore stability, prevent further structural damage, and prepare the property for future use or development. Building raising can accommodate different types of foundations, including concrete slabs, pier and beam systems, or crawl spaces, depending on the property's design and the specific needs of the project.
This service helps resolve problems associated with foundation settlement, flooding, or moisture intrusion. Properties that have experienced uneven settling, cracks in walls, or issues with water infiltration often benefit from building raising. By elevating the structure, it becomes less vulnerable to floodwaters or ongoing ground movement, which can cause further damage over time. Building raising also provides an opportunity to upgrade or replace outdated foundations, improve overall structural integrity, and enhance the property's resilience against environmental challenges.
Properties that typically utilize building raising services include older homes, especially those with crawl spaces or pier and beam foundations, as well as commercial buildings located in flood-prone areas. Residential properties situated in low-lying regions or near bodies of water often require elevation to meet local floodplain management requirements. Additionally, properties undergoing renovations or expansions may opt for building raising to ensure a stable foundation before proceeding with construction or remodeling projects.

The overview below groups typical Building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Milwaukee, WI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Preparation Costs - Preparing a site for building raising can range from $2,000 to $6,000, depending on soil conditions and the size of the structure. For example, a small residential building might cost around $3,000, while larger projects could be higher.
Building Raising Services - The cost to lift a building typically falls between $10,000 and $30,000, with prices influenced by the building’s size and complexity. A standard single-family home might cost approximately $15,000 to $20,000 for the lift.
Foundation Repair and Reinforcement - After raising, foundation repairs or reinforcements usually range from $5,000 to $15,000, depending on the extent of work needed. Minor repairs may be closer to $5,000, while extensive work can reach higher amounts.
Additional Costs and Permits - Permitting and inspection fees for building raising projects can add $1,000 to $3,000 to the overall cost. These expenses vary based on local regulations and project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is building raising? Building raising involves elevating a structure to prevent flood damage, improve foundation stability, or accommodate new construction projects.
Why might a building need to be raised? Buildings may need to be raised due to flood risk, foundation issues, or to meet local zoning requirements.
How do professionals raise a building? Local contractors typically lift a building using hydraulic jacks and support it on temporary or permanent piers during the process.
Is building raising suitable for all types of structures? Building raising is most common for residential and small commercial buildings; suitability depends on the structure's design and condition.
